In a time marked by social change and the quest for personal identity, "Asa Holmes; or, At the Cross-Roads" by Annie F. Johnston explores the intricate dynamics of a rural community. The narrative weaves together themes of wisdom and character building, as young Asa grapples with pivotal choices that shape his future. Readers will encounter the profound influence of mentorship and the clash between tradition and modernity, illustrated through vivid character interactions.
